Required License/Registration/Certification Credential of Registered Dietitian Nutritionist ( RDN ), preferred Job Summary The Department of Dietetics and Human Nutrition at the University of Kentucky in the College of Agriculture, Food and Environment seeks a candidate for a full-time, twelve-month, tenure-track faculty position at the Assistant level, with a start date of July 1, 2019. The distribution of effort is approximately 70% Research, 25% Instruction and 5% Service. Faculty assignments and division of efforts are subject to annual negotiation between the chair and faculty member. Successful applicants will be prepared to lead a collaborative research program and provide excellent student learning opportunities. The Department of Dietetics and Human Nutrition ( DHN ) offers outstanding higher education opportunities for students passionate about food, health, and wellness. Our undergraduate program in Human Nutrition provides a strong foundation to prepare students for dental, medical, optometry, pharmacy, physical therapy, or physician assistant studies. We also have a long history of preparing successful Registered Dietitians for a rewarding career through our accredited didactic, coordinated, and internship programs. Faculty in DHN are engaged in a wide variety of research, from food environment and culture to exercise and physiology. We value community engagement and offer award-winning Cooperative Extension Service programs through Family and Consumer Sciences Extension to help Kentuckians live their best lives.
